wgrk.net
当前位置:首页 >> ios wEBviEw 禁止滚动 >>

ios wEBviEw 禁止滚动

在UIScrollView没有什么方法,不过有一个方法可以达到你的目标,这是我的方法: - (void)disableBounce { for (id subview in self.subviews) if ([[subview class] isSubclassOfClass: [UIScrollView class]]) ((UIScrollView *)subview).bounc...

-webkit-overflow-scrolling: touch

去掉滚动条代码如下: UIWebView * d_intro = [[UIWebView alloc] init]; d_intro.delegate = self; d_intro.dataDetectorTypes = UIDataDetectorTypeLink; //取消右侧,下侧滚动条,去处上下滚动边界的黑色背景 d_intro.backgroundColor=[UICol...

ios5里面可以用这个设置 self.scrollView.scrollEnabled = NO; 但是要支持全系列的机器就不能这么干了 利用 [cpp] view plain copy - (void)disableBounce { // [[[self subviews] lastObject] setScrollingEnabled:NO]; for (id subview in sel...

detailWebView.setFocusable(false); wb_company_address = (WebView) findViewById(R.id.wb_company_address); wb_company_address.loadUrl("file:///android_asset/test1.html"); wb_company_address.setWebViewClient(new MyWebViewClient())...

用这个WebView wv = new WebView(context){ @Override public boolean onTouchEvent(android.view.MotionEvent event) { //在这里根据你的需要捕获 }; };computeHorizontalScrollRange()还有个类似的,computeVerticalScrollRange()这就差不多了...

没有冲突吧? 如果你触摸的地方是webView,那么响应的只可能是webView,如果在webView之外,就是scrollview响应。 当然,如果webView滑动到边界了,再拉也会作用在scrollview上的。如果你设置webview不可滚动,那就没有任何问题了。

从webview上禁止是禁止不了的,保证网页的宽度自适应,自然就没有左右滑动之说了。

您好,webview中也是包含着一个子 uiscrollview的,相当于两个scrollview,能跟着一起动就好了。

package com.jcodecraeer.mobile.view; import android.content.Context; import android.util.AttributeSet; import android.webkit.WebView; /** * Created by jianghejie on 15/7/16. */ public class ObservableWebView extends WebView { p...

网站首页 | 网站地图
All rights reserved Powered by www.wgrk.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com